  • Not exactly a FAQ, but Chapter 9 in the GR-33 Manual is titled Connecting to External Sound Generators and Sequencers. Here is an excerpt from Page 88:


    "When the pedal or [VALUE] is used to change patches on the GR-33, a Program Change (tone change) message is sent to the external device from MIDI OUT. This can be used to change tones on the external sound generator or to change patches for guitar-sound effects. The number of the Program Change message that is sent can be freely changed and saved to the patches on the GR-33. (At the time of purchase, Program Change numbers 1 through 128 are assigned sequentially to patches A11 through D84.)"


    In other words, you can MIDI Map the GR-33 so the MIDI PC Numbers assigned to your KPA rigs do not have to align with your GR-33 preset numbers.
